Pasadena Unified Schools Inspire a Love of Reading During Read Across America Week



Pasadena Unified School District (PUSD) schools enthusiastically celebrated the joy of reading during Read Across America Week with a variety of engaging activities designed to inspire a love of literature among students. Throughout the week, classrooms hosted interactive storytelling sessions, creative reading challenges, and themed events that encouraged students to explore new books. Special guest readers, including local community leaders, educators, and parents, visited campuses to share their favorite stories, fostering a sense of excitement and appreciation for reading across all grade levels.
